Nepal heads into their crucial T20 World Cup 2026 Group C match against Italy with renewed confidence and momentum, following a highly competitive performance against England. The match is scheduled for today at the Wankhede Stadium in Mumbai, starting at 3:00 PM IST.


Nepal’s Strong Display Against England

Nepal came within four runs of a historic victory over England in their opening match, finishing on 180/6 while chasing 185. Key contributions from captain Rohit Paudel, Dipendra Singh Airee, and Lokesh Bam’s explosive unbeaten 39 off 20 balls showcased the team’s improved depth and fearless approach. Although Sam Curran’s composed final over secured the win for England, Nepal’s performance earned widespread respect and significantly boosted the squad’s belief.

Captain Rohit Paudel has stated that the team feels “much stronger and more prepared” than in previous tournaments, underlining their readiness to convert strong performances into victories.

Italy Clash: A Key Opportunity

Italy, making their T20 World Cup debut, bring experience from players such as Wayne Madsen but face a confident Nepal side on a batting-friendly Wankhede pitch. For Nepal, a win would deliver their first World Cup victory in over a decade and strengthen their position in the group standings.


Broader Context: Associate Nations Impressing

Nepal’s progress is part of a larger positive trend in the tournament. Several associate teams have delivered competitive performances, including the Netherlands pushing Pakistan close, Zimbabwe securing a convincing win over Oman, and other emerging sides showing they can challenge full-member nations. The expanded 20-team format is clearly fostering greater competitiveness and global participation in T20 cricket.
